My first look is something I call Girly Plaid.

I love the look of a crinkly plaid shirt in a somewhat masculine color scheme (black, gray, and teal) mixed with something uber feminine like black patent Steve Madden heels. I created this look after getting my latest Old Navy purchase in the mail last night - the plaid shirt you see above. At $14, it was a total steal. It's comfy and light, and can be worn in either warm or cool months.

When I tried the shirt on, I discovered a baggy cut. I like my shirts a bit more fitted, so I cinched it with a black belt to give a more hourglass, girly shape. Skinny jeans, Etsy jewelry, straight hair, and heels really gave this outfit a more complete finish.
